How much do customer development manager j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 9, 2026, the average yearly pay for customer development manager in Largo, FL is $77,299.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$50,000.00 and $95,700.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Customer Development Man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Customer Development Manager, you need expertise in sales strategy, account management, and market analysis, often supported by a degree in business or marketing. Familiarity with CRM software, data analytics platforms, and sales automation tools is typically essential. Exceptional communication, relationship-building, and negotiation skills help you stand out in this position. These competencies are crucial for driving revenue growth, fostering long-term client partnerships, and achieving business objectives.

How does a Customer Development Manager typically collaborate with sales and marketing teams to drive business growth?

A Customer Development Manager works closely with both sales and marketing teams to identify growth opportunities and ensure that customer needs are at the forefront of business strategies. This collaboration often involves sharing market insights, co-developing customer engagement plans, and aligning on promotional activities. By bridging communication between departments, the Customer Development Manager helps to create unified approaches that enhance customer relationships and drive revenue. Regular cross-functional meetings and joint planning sessions are common practices to maintain alignment and achieve shared goals.

What is the difference between Customer Development Manager vs Sales Representative?

AspectCustomer Development ManagerSales Representative
Primary FocusBuilding long-term customer relationships and strategic growthClosing sales and meeting sales targets
Required SkillsCustomer relationship management, strategic planning, communicationPersuasion, product knowledge, negotiation
Work EnvironmentCorporate, B2B, account managementField sales, retail, direct client interaction
Common CertificationsCRM certifications, sales or marketing coursesSales certifications, product-specific training

The Customer Development Manager focuses on developing long-term relationships and strategic growth with clients, often working in B2B environments. In contrast, a Sales Representative primarily aims to close individual sales and meet targets. While both roles require strong communication skills and industry knowledge, their core objectives and daily activities differ significantly.

Job description

Job Title: Business Development Manager

Location (city, state): Tampa, FL (Onsite / Field-Based)

Industry: Real Estate Development / Telecommunications

Compensation: $75,000 - $95,000 + commission

Work Schedule: Monday – Friday, standard business hours

Benefits: This position is eligible for medical, dental, vision, and 401(k).

About Our Client:

Addison Group is partnering with a rapidly growing organization that delivers advanced connectivity solutions to large-scale residential developments. Our client works closely with developers and builders to provide fully managed infrastructure solutions and is expanding their footprint across high-growth markets.

Job Description:

We are seeking a highly driven Business Development Manager with a true hunter mentality to generate new business and build strategic partnerships. This role is ideal for someone who thrives in a field-based sales environment, enjoys engaging with senior decision-makers, and wants to play a key role in driving company growth.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Build and manage a strong outbound sales pipeline to identify and secure new business opportunities
  • Present solutions to senior stakeholders, including executives and ownership groups, to drive partnership agreements
  • Develop and maintain long-term relationships with developers, builders, and key industry partners
  • Represent the organization at industry events, trade shows, and networking functions to generate leads
  • Lead the full sales cycle from prospecting through contract execution
  • Deliver tailored presentations that clearly communicate value and differentiate offerings
  • Track and report on pipeline activity, deal progress, and revenue forecasts
  • Partner with internal teams to align sales efforts with operational capabilities and market strategy
  • Identify opportunities to improve processes, expand market reach, and increase efficiency

Qualifications:

  • 5+ years of experience in business development, outside sales, or strategic partnerships with a strong focus on new business generation
  • Proven success selling to VP-level, C-suite, or ownership-level decision-makers
  • Experience managing the full sales cycle from initial outreach to close
  • Background in real estate development, telecommunications, fiber, or related industries preferred
  • Strong technical aptitude with CRM systems (experience with tools like Monday.com or Airtable is a plus)
  • Excellent communication, presentation, and relationship-building skills
  • Self-starter with the ability to operate independently and take initiative beyond core responsibilities

Additional Details:

  • This is a field-based role requiring onsite presence and client engagement
  • Candidates should be comfortable attending industry events and traveling locally as needed
  • Established lead lists and ongoing lead generation tools are provided to support pipeline development
  • Interview process includes virtual and onsite meetings with leadership
